ORDER
This writ petition has been filed for a Mandamus seeking for a direction to the second respondent to dispose of the petitioner's application dated 04.10.2021 and subsequent representation dated 01.02.2022, submitted under the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007, within a time frame to be fixed by this Court.
2.Heard Mr.R.Karunanithi, learned counsel for the petitioner and Mr.M.Lingadurai, learned Special Government Pleader appearing for the respondents.
3.The petitioner is aged about 72 years and is a Senior Citizen. She has submitted an application under the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007, seeking cancellation of settlement deeds executed by her in favour of her 1/3
children. According to the petitioner, her children despite the said settlement deeds, have not maintained her and in such circumstances, she has filed the application under the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007, seeking for cancellation of the settlement deeds. Since the application dated 04.10.2021 and her subsequent representation dated 01.02.2022 has not been considered till date by the second respondent, she has filed this writ petition.
4.No prejudice will be caused to the respondents if the petitioner's application dated 04.10.2021 filed before the second respondent under the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007, is disposed of expeditiously on merits and in accordance with law. The petitioner is also aged about 72 years and therefore, the application will have to be disposed of expeditiously.
5.Therefore, this Court directs the second respondent to dispose of the petitioner's application dated 04.10.2021 and the subsequent representation dated 01.02.2022 submitted by her under the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007, against her children seeking for cancellation of settlement deeds executed by her earlier and pass final orders on merits and in accordance with law after hearing the petitioner and her children and after affording fair opportunity to both parties, within a period of three months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
6.With the aforesaid directions, this writ petition is disposed of. No costs.
